Removal Procedure

WARNING: This page is about a different car, the 2002 Pontiac Montana, 2002 Oldsmobile Silhouette, and 2002 Chevrolet Venture. However, it is still accessible from the selected car via links, so may be relevant.
CAUTION: Following the deployment of a side impact air bag, Inspect the following parts for damage. Replace these parts if necessary:
  • The seat cushion frame
  • The seat recliner, If equipped
  • The seat adjuster
  • The seat back frame

Failure to do so may cause future personal Injury. 

  1. Disable the SIR system. Refer to Disabling the SIR System .
  2. Remove the passenger front seat. Refer to SEAT REPLACEMENT - BUCKET .
  3. Remove the J-clips on the back of the passenger's seat.
  4. Using a flat head screwdriver, remove the plastic molding (2) that holds the air bag inflator module (1) to the passenger seat back frame.
    Fig 1: Removing J-Clips, Plastic Molding & Air Bag Inflator Module (RH)
    G01814813Courtesy of GENERAL MOTORS CORP.
  5. Note the routing of the inflator module wiring harness (2) and the retaining clip attachments within the passenger seat.
  6. Remove the wiring harness retaining clips from the passenger seat frame.
  7. Remove the wiring harness (2) from the passenger seat frame.
  8. Remove the air bag inflator module (1) from the passenger seat back frame.
  9. Fully deploy the module before disposal. If the module was replaced under warranty, fully deploy and dispose of the module after the required retention period. Refer to Inflator Module Handling and Scrapping .
